Similar Listings
2012 Crosstour Engine Computer Control Module ECU 112K Miles OE - LKQ391658475
2012 Rav4 Engine Computer Control Module ECU 112K Miles OE - LKQ445368864
2019 Subaru WRX Engine Computer Control Module ECU 112K Miles OE - LKQ404006680
2012 Legacy Engine Computer Control Module ECU 112K Miles OE - LKQ411963846
2012 Kia Soul Engine Computer Control Module ECU 112K Miles OE - LKQ307377296
2012 Highlander Engine Computer Control Module ECU 112K Miles OE - LKQ403947447
2012 Pilot Engine Computer Control Module ECU 112K Miles OE - LKQ448132947
2012 Prius Engine Computer Control Module ECU 112K Miles OE - LKQ408587797